This Labour Day, Angela and I spent the weekend at the Verhoeven's cottage on Baptiste Lake, near Bancroft. The very first night we were treated to one of the best aurora borealis shows that I have ever seen. The cottage is on the lake and it faces due north, so the view was fantastic. I quickly grabbed my camera and tripod and did my best to photograph the event before it disappeared. So, this is a view from the dock across Baptiste Lake on that night.
This was shot with the Rebel XT + kit lens at 18mm, ISO-800, f/3.5, 18 second exposure. I would have preferred to use my new Canon 1.8 prime lens, but unfortunately I didn't pack it as I wasn't expecting to do any astrophotography.
